Clean room for the food industry
Clean rooms are sized according to ISO 14644-1:2015 and FS209 standards are constructed with totally sanitizable wall and ceiling paneling. Food or pharmaceutical cleanroom control parameters are managed by fully customizable programmable management PLCs connected to the telehealth network, and air handling units are equipped with filter fouling sensors that promptly indicate when filters need to be replaced. Depending on production requirements, air flows can be of two types:
- unidirectional vertical flow in which the supplied absolute filters are housed on a hood to direct the outflow of clean air while the return air grilles are placed on the lower parts of the room.
- Turbulent flow, where the sanitized work area is the entire production department
